html {margin:0; padding:0;}
body {
	background-color: #33CCCC;
	background : url('../images/fond_princ.gif');
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 24px;
	color: #336699;
	margin:0;
	padding:0
}
.main {margin-left: 15%; padding: 2em 3em 0em 3.25em;} 
div#main {margin-left: 15%; padding: 2em 3em 0em 3.25em;}

div#entete h1, h2 {	font-family: Cursive, Verdana, sans-serif;
					color: white;}
div#entete h1 {	font: bold 28px/0.66em Cursive, Arial, Verdana, sans-serif;
   				border-bottom: 1px solid #A5B5D6;
   				background: #113f85; 
				letter-spacing: 0.25em;
   				padding: 0.5em 0 0 1.66em; 
				margin: 0;}
div#entete h2 {	font: bold 28px/1em Cursive, Arial, Verdana, sans-serif;
   				padding: 0.15em 2em 0 7.5%; 
				margin: 0;
   				letter-spacing: 0.25em;
				border-width: 0 0 2px 1em;}
div#entete {background: #113f85; 
			margin: 0; 
			padding: 0;}



div#sitenav {	border-left:0px none; border-top:0px none; border-bottom:0px none; background-color: #D5F9D5; 
				border-right: 5px solid #A5B5D6;
   				float: left; 
				width: 17%; 
				font-size: 90%; 
   				padding: 0; margin-left:0; margin-right:0; margin-top:1em; margin-bottom:0}
   
div#sitenav h4 {padding: 0.15em 0 0 0.5em; 
				margin: 0 0 0.25em;
   				font-size: 100%; 
				letter-spacing: 0.30em; 
   				background: #A5B5D6 ;}
				
div#sitenav a {	display: block; 
   				padding: 0.5em 0.5em 0 0.66em; 
				margin-right: 0%;
   				border-bottom: 1px solid #D5F9D5; 
				text-decoration: none;}
div#sitenav a:link {color: #123f85;}
div#sitenav a:visited {color: #421c8f;}
div#sitenav a:hover {	color: #1c29a8;
   						border-bottom-color: #A5B5D6;;
   						background: #A5B5D6;}
div#sitenav a:active {color: #8f1c42;}



H2 {
    font-family : Verdana, Arial, Helvetica, sans-serif;
    font-size : 16pt;
    font-weight : normal;
}
H3 {
    font-family : Cursive, Arial, Helvetica, sans-serif;
    font-size : 12pt;
    font-weight : normal;
}
LI {
  font-size : 11px;
  font-family : "Verdana", Arial, Helvetica, sans-serif;
}

.img {
	background-image: url('../images/Oise.png');
	background-repeat:no-repeat;
	background-position: center 50%;
}

.small {font-size: 12px;
        font-style:italic;
        color: black;}
.mini {	font-size: 11px;}
.minimini { font-size: 9px;
						font-style: normal;
            text-align : justify; 
            line-height: 1.5em; 
						color: #0000FF;
						margin: 0;
						padding: 0;
}

.accueil {
	
	color: #0000c0;
	font-family: cursive,Arial,Helvetica,sans-serif; 
	font-style: italic; 
	font-size: 50px;
}

.TitreSection1 {
  	padding-left : 8px;
  	padding-top : 3px;
  	padding-bottom : 3px;
	color : white;
 	background-color : #2076BD;
  	font-weight : bold;
  	text-align : left;
  	font-size : 14px;
  	font-family : "Verdana", Arial, Helvetica, sans-serif;
  	text-decoration : none;
}

.TitreSection2 {
  margin-left : 40 px;
  margin-top : 30px;
  padding-left : 8px;
  padding-top : 2px;
  padding-bottom : 2px;
  spacing-top : 2px;
  color : white;
  background-color : #6389d8;
  font-weight : bold;
  text-align : left;
  font-size : 12px;
  font-family : "Verdana";
  text-decoration : none;
}

.paragraph {
  margin-left:20px;
  margin-right:15px;
  color : #0000FF;
  font-weight : normal;
  text-align : justify;
  font-size : 12px;
  font-family : "Verdana", Arial, Helvetica, sans-serif;
  text-decoration : none;
  line-height : 150%;
}

.titre {
  margin-left:20px;
  margin-right:15px;
  color : #0000FF;
  font-weight : bold;
  text-align : justify;
  font-size : 16px;
  font-family : "Verdana", Arial, Helvetica, sans-serif;
  text-decoration : none;
  line-height : 200%;
}

.ffss {
  margin-left:20px;
  margin-right:15px;
  color : #0000FF;
  font-weight : normal;
  text-align : justify;
  font-size : 15px;
  font-family : "Verdana", Arial, Helvetica, sans-serif;
  text-decoration : none;
  line-height : 200%;
}

.titreArticle {
  color : #FFFFFF;
  font-weight : bold;
  text-align : center;
  font-size : 16pt;
  font-family : "Verdana";
  text-decoration : none;
}

.summaryIndent0 {
  color : #334878;
  margin-left : 0px;
  font-weight : bold;
  font-size : 14px;
  font-family : "Verdana", Arial, Helvetica, sans-serif;
  text-decoration : none;
  line-height : 300%;
}

.Style1 {
	color: #FF0000;
	font-weight: bold;
}

.li {
	color: #0000FF;
	font-weight: bold;
}
.lm {
	color: #0000FF;
	font-weight: bold;
}
